Despite the intervening years and ... May 18, 2012 · Plot. Professor Barbenfouillis proposes the building of a rocket to the Moon before a group of fellow astronomers. The rocket is launched from a giant cannon and impacts into the Man in the Moon’s eye. Its crew explore the lunar surface and encounter the native Selenites. After finishing work on the film, Georges Méliès intended to release it in America and thereby make lots of money. Unfortunately, Thomas A. Edison 's film technicians had already secretly made copies of it, which were shown across the US within weeks. This resource was produced to accompany the BFI's Sci-Fi Days of Fear ...The first film to show lunar travel is French filmmaker Georges Méliès’s Le voyage dans la Lune ( A Trip to the Moon, 1902). It was inspired by Jules Vernes’s novels From the Earth to the Moon (1865) and Around the Moon (1870), as well as The First Men in the Moon (1901) by H.G. Wells. Every moviegoer has at least once seen the famous frame with the moon face “cut” by a bullet in …That image from A Trip to the Moon is so famous that it is instantly recognizable even to people who have never seen a single silent film. It has been referenced and imitated in everything from children’s books to music videos.
